Chirrut... has a problem. Normally when Chirrut has a problem, it isn't much of an issue - he has Baze, and together they can figure out most things (or by then Master Sheotar has figured out they're up to something because she knows everything and somehow problems have a way of refocusing themselves when she's around).

But this time, Chirrut can't go to Baze.

Because he's pretty sure he'll either embarrass or horrify Baze with this particular... problem.

...

So how, exactly, is he supposed to stop having a crush on his best friend?

Chirrut is spending extra time on the training mats tonight, trying to drive himself to exhaustion. A dream-free night... would be good.
